Heavy Equipment and Truck Show to spotlight Tata Motors' cutting-edge mobility solutions
Published in The Saudi Gazette on 06 - 11 - 2024

The Heavy Equipment and Truck Show (HEAT) announced the participation of Tata Motors, a leading global automotive manufacturer at this year's event.
Scheduled to take place from 18-21 November at the Dhahran Expo in Dammam, Tata Motors will showcase a wide range of advanced cargo and passenger mobility solutions, including heavy-duty tippers, trucks and tractors all equipped with latest technology and engineered to meet the evolving needs of the region's customers.
A trusted brand with a strong legacy, Tata Motors remains a leader in delivering innovative solutions for the global logistics and construction industries. As a leading player in the commercial vehicle industry, Tata Motors' participation is poised to provide valuable insights into the future of commercial vehicles and heavy machinery.
Sharing his thoughts, Raz Islam, Managing Director, CPI Trade Media, said, "We are thrilled to welcome Tata Motors to HEAT show 2024. Their participation marks a major highlight and reflects the company's long-term commitment to the Middle Eastern market. Attendees will have a unique opportunity to explore Tata Motors' cutting-edge innovations, each set to establish new benchmarks for reliability and performance."
Commenting on the company's participation, Anurag Mehrotra, Head – International Business, Tata Motors Commercial Vehicles, said, "Saudi Arabia remains a vital market for Tata Motors, and the HEAT show presents an excellent opportunity to engage with stakeholders and demonstrate our commitment towards developing solutions that meet the evolving needs of our customers. Our exhibits, cutting across cargo and passenger mobility solutions will highlight our consistent focus on efficiency, reliability, and safety, ensuring our solutions contribute to our customers' long term success and profitability."
Set to take place in Dammam, the gateway to Saudi Arabia's Eastern Province and a key industrial hub, the event aligns with the Kingdom's Vision 2030 initiative, aimed at diversifying the economy and promoting sustainable development. The strategic location further enhances the HEAT show's role in fostering innovation and growth within the construction sector.
The show will be co-located with the International Construction & Interior Design Expo (CIDEX) 2024, providing a broader platform for exhibitors and attendees to explore opportunities within Saudi Arabia's booming construction and interior design market.
